DELUXE INSTRUMENT PANEL SETUP
Deluxe Panel Upgrade
Icon Identification
Figure 176
Make selection by pressing SELECTION BUTTON
opposite the Icon [Figure 176].
B-16162
EXAMPLE
SELECTION BUTTON
ICON
DESCRIPTION
LOCK / UNLOCK: Allows machine to be locked/
unlocked. You must lock machine to activate
security system.
When system is unlocked, the user can press
RUN / ENTER then press START to begin
operation.
A valid password will need to be entered at startup
to run a locked machine.
TOOL / SETUP: Access system options.
Use to set clock, check system warnings, select
language, set passwords, etc.
?
HELP: Access help on current menu item.
EXIT
EXIT returns you to previous level menu.
11:23
0.0
CLOCK / JOB CLOCK: Press to clear or lock job
clock; TOOL/SETUP to set time.
UP ARROW: Goes backward one screen.
DOWN ARROW: Goes forward one screen.
OUTLINE ARROWS: No screen available
(backward/forward).
SELECTION ARROW: Use to select menu item.
NEXT
Goes to the NEXT screen in series. EXAMPLE:
the next Active Warning screen.
INFO
Goes to more information about an attachment.
YES / NO Answer yes/no to current setup question.
CLEAR
Removes previously installed password.
SET
Set accepts current installed password.
